Subject: [PATCH v3 0/4] Add QMP V3 USB3 PHY support for SC7180
Date: Wed, 12 Feb 2020 16:51:24 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1581506488-26881-1-git-send-email-sanm@codeaurora.org> (raw)

Add QMP V3 USB3 PHY entries for SC7180 in phy driver and
device tree bindings.

changes in v3:
*Addressed Rob's comments in yaml file.
*Sepearated the SC7180 support in yaml patch.
*corrected the phy reset entries in device tree.

changes in v2:
*Remove global phy reset in QMP phy.
*Convert QMP phy bindings to yaml.

Sandeep Maheswaram (4):
  dt-bindings: phy: qcom,qmp: Convert QMP phy bindings to yaml
  dt-bindings: phy: qcom,qmp: Add support for SC7180
  phy: qcom-qmp: Add QMP V3 USB3 PHY support for SC7180
  arm64: dts: qcom: sc7180: Correct qmp phy reset entries
